摘要
本试验研究不同钴水平对肉羊维生素B12的合成、瘤胃发酵及造血机能的影响。20只健康、体重相近(2 7.3±0.9)kg的杂交一代羯羊,平均分为5组,分别饲喂基础日粮(含钴0.0 8 6 mg/kg)、基础日粮中添加0.2 5、0.5 0、0.7 5和1.00 mg/kg钴的试验组日粮,饲粮进食量相同,试验期8周。结果表明,基础日粮中0.086 mg/kg的钴不能满足肉羊的需要,添加0.25~1.00 mg/kg钴,可促进瘤胃维生素B12的合成,其合成量随饲喂时间的延长而增加,6周后趋于稳定,第6、8周的平均值为31.70~44.83 nmol/L,钴的添加量低于0.50 mg/kg时瘤胃维生素B12的含量增加较快,超过该量增加的幅度延缓。添加0.50 mg/kg的钴可显著增加瘤胃总挥发性脂肪酸的产生量并使其中丙酸比例增加、异丁酸和异戊酸比例降低。添加0.25 mg/kg的钴即可维持正常的造血功能。建议肉羊日粮中钴的适宜添加水平为0.25~0.50 mg/kg(即适宜日粮钴水平为0.336~0.586 mg/kg)。
To evaluate the effects of different inclusion levels of dietary cobalt on vitamin B12 synthesis, rumen fermentation and blood parameters of sheep, twenty cannulated wethers with an average weight (27.3 ± 0.9) kg were randomly divided into five groups and fed diets supplemented with increasing levels of cobalt (0, 0.25, 0.50, 0.75 and 1.00 mg Co/kg DM) for 8 weeks. Results showed cobalt content of control diet (0.086 mg Co/kg DM) was inadequate for achieving optimal rumen fermentation and sustaining normal blood function. Supplementation of 0.25, 0.50, 0.75 and 1.00 mg Co/kg DM significantly (P〈0.05) improved rumen vitamin B12 concentration which was increased after feeding time, but being stable 6 weeks with the average values of 1.70, 40.96, 42.92 and 44.83 nmol/L at the end of 6 and 8 weeks of feeding respectively. Lambs supplemented with 0.50 mg Co/kg DM seemed to be beneficial for rumen total volatile fatty acid production and molar proportion of propionate, whereas iso-acids were impaired by Co supplementation. Supplemention of 0.25 mg Co/kg DM is enough to meet the requirement of sustaining normal blood function. Supplemention of Co for lambs is recommended to be 0.25 to 0.50 mg/kg DM (total diet Co is 0. 336-0. 586 mg/kg DM).
